About The Position

Carteret Community College is launching its NJCAA athletics programs and seeks a dynamic, student-centered leader as Assistant Athletic Director. This role is crucial in building a competitive, mission-driven athletics program that enhances student engagement, promotes academic success, and strengthens campus and community pride. The Assistant Athletic Director will significantly influence operations, support coaches and student-athletes, and establish a culture of integrity, excellence, and inclusivity aligned with the College’s commitment to student success. This position serves as the primary Sports Information Director (SID) and assists the Athletic Director in the administration, promotion, and operational oversight of the intercollegiate athletics program. Key areas of support include NJCAA-compliant operations, athletic communications, marketing, donor and sponsor engagement, and comprehensive game-day management.

Requirements

  • Associate's degree required.
  • Minimum of 1–2 years of experience in athletic administration or playing at the collegiate level.
  • NJCAA experience preferred.
  • Strong communication and technical skills.
  • Proven capacity to foster a positive team culture and uphold the values of Carteret Community College.
  • Strong organizational and time-management skills.
  • A valid driver's license.

Nice To Haves

  • Bachelor's degree in Physical Education, Sports Management, or a related field.
  • CPR/First Aid certification.

Responsibilities

  • Assist with eligibility certification, roster management, and NJCAA compliance.
  • Support academic monitoring and reporting requirements.
  • Serve as Sports Information Director (SID) for Carteret Community College Athletics.
  • Maintain statistical records and submit required NJCAA reports.
  • Write and distribute press releases, game recaps, previews, and feature stories.
  • Coordinate media relations and serve as liaison with the NJCAA, conference offices, and opposing institutions.
  • Maintain and manage the athletic website, including schedules, rosters, statistics, news, and multimedia content.
  • Coordinate live stats and post-game reporting.
  • Lead athletic marketing efforts per institutional branding standards, manage social media platforms, coordinate promotions, group sales, theme nights, and community outreach initiatives to increase attendance and engagement.
  • Lead athletic sponsorship outreach and solicitation efforts and ensure fulfillment of athletic donor and sponsor benefits, including signage, public address announcements, and digital recognition.
  • Coordinate sponsor visibility at athletic events.
  • Administer student-athlete insurance and support management of institutional insurance policies, including claims processing, compliance, and coordination with providers.
  • Hire, train, and supervise game-day staff.
  • Coordinate officials and event operations.
  • Set up, operate, and break down concession stands and manage cash handling per college policy.
  • Assist with the collection, laundering, distribution, and inventory of athletic uniforms, equipment, and practice gear.
  • Develop, promote, and coordinate athletic camps, supporting program growth, community engagement, and revenue generation.
